Mahogany Chicken Wings

Mahogany Chicken Wings

4.5

Prep
15 min
Cook
50 min
Total
125 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Mix together soy sauce, honey, molasses, chile sauce, garlic, and ginger in a shallow bowl. Add chicken; turn to coat evenly. Cover the bowl and chill in the refrigerator for 1 hour, turning occasionally.
  2. 2 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  3. 3 Arrange chicken in a single layer in a large baking dish; reserve marinade in the bowl for basting.
  4. 4 Bake in the preheated oven, turning once and basting often with reserved marinade, until meat is no longer pink and the juices run clear, about 50 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center of a wing should read at least 165 degrees F (74 degrees C). Discard any leftover marinade.

Pumpkin Pie Seeds

Pumpkin Pie Seeds

4.5

Prep
10 min
Cook
55 min
Total
95 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Place pumpkin seeds, water, and salt in a saucepan, bring to a boil, and reduce heat to medium; boil seeds for 10 minutes. Drain seeds but do not rinse. Pat seeds dry with paper towels and spread out onto a work surface or a baking sheet for 30 minutes to dry.
  2. 2 Preheat oven to 250 degrees F (120 degrees C).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il.
  3. 3 Melt butter in a large microwave-safe bowl until melted, about 1 minute. Toss seeds in the melted butter and mix in 1 tablespoon sugar, c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, cloves, and cardamom; toss again to coat seeds thoroughly with spices. Spread seeds out onto the prepared baking sheet in a single layer.
  4. 4 Bake in the preheated oven until toasted and crunchy, 45 minutes to 1 hour. Stir several times during baking. Sprinkle toasted seeds with 1 tablespoon sugar or as desired; cool before serving.

Spicy Ginger Chicken Wings

Spicy Ginger Chicken Wings

4.7

Prep
20 min
Cook
45 min
Total
65 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Preheat an o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  2. 2 Blot chicken wings dry with a paper towel.
  3. 3 Beat the eggs in a bowl, and place the flour in another bowl. Dip chicken wings into the egg, then into the flour to lightly coat, shaking off the excess.
  4. 4 Melt the margarine in a large skillet over medium high heat.
  5. 5 Pan fry the chicken wings until well browned on all sides, about 10 minutes.
  6. 6 Meanwhile, gently boil the cider vinegar, soy sauce, water, brown sugar, monosodium glutamate, salt, serrano chile peppers, and ginger in a saucepan over medium heat until thickened, 5 to 7 minutes.
  7. 7 Toss the browned chicken wings in the sauce to coat, then transfer the wings to large baking dish with a slotted spoon. Reserve remaining sauce.
  8. 8 Bake in the preheated oven until the chicken is no longer pink in the center, about 30 minutes, rotating and basting with the reserved sauce after 15 minutes.
  9. 9 Sprinkle sesame seeds on the chicken wings before serving.

Crispy Baked Moroccan Chicken Wings with Yogurt Dip

Crispy Baked Moroccan Chicken Wings with Yogurt Dip

4.5

Prep
20 min
Cook
40 min
Total
60 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C). Line a baking sheet with nonstick aluminum foil.
  2. 2 Place chicken wings into a large bowl, drizzle with oil, and toss until thoroughly coated.
  3. 3 Stir paprika, cumin, salt, cinnamon, ginger, cayenne pepper, turmeric, and black pepper together in a small bowl. Sprinkle spice mixture over wings and toss to coat.
  4. 4 Arrange wings in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et, spacing them apart so they aren't touching.
  5. 5 Bake in the preheated oven until no longer pink at the bone and the juices run clear, 40 to 45 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ted near the bone should read 165 degrees F (74 degrees C).
  6. 6 Meanwhile, make the yogurt dip: Stir yogurt, lemon juice, honey, mint, cilantro, salt, and pepper together in a small bowl. Taste dip and season with additional salt and pepper as desired.
  7. 7 Remove wings from the oven and transfer to a serving platter. Serve with yogurt dip.
